We are sizing down and sadly selling our Keystone. I love this trailer. It is fabulous quality, great floor plan and the finishes are superior to any other similar brands we shopped for. At 4600 pounds dry it easily tows with a 1/2 ton pick up and is easier to park than longer models. The central ducted heating and air is so comfortable, the walk around queen is awesome. A double door refrigerator/freezer has lots of room and the amount of storage both in and outside is amazing. We were able to put a queen sleep number bed in ours and also a electric clothes washer spinner in the bathroom cabinet. If we still needed the room we would not sell it.

The slide-out really helps with space. It\'s so convenient to have the bed available, instead of having to build it from collapsing a table. Tows easily -- we tow with a Nissan Titan with a tow package. Sway bars are very helpful, as is the electric jack. Has only had 2 occupants over the years we have owned it - haven\'t used it as much as we thought we would - only 100 nights over 7 years of owning it.
